Oktay Kaynarca Turkish TV Legend Start New Chapter 

Oktay Kaynarca has long been a powerhouse in Turkish television. Best known internationally for his performances in Eşkıya Dünyaya Hükümdar Olmaz (Bandits) and Ben Bu Cihana Sığmazam (The World Is Not Enough for Me), the actor now returns with Kafkas, a gripping story that blends loyalty, family, and ambition.

The series marks another milestone in Kaynarca’s illustrious career, promising to explore new emotional depths and showcase the actor in a powerful, commanding role that resonates with both Turkish and international audiences.

Behind the Scenes: KYN Yapım, Mehmet Ercan Erdem, and Mustafa Şevki Doğan

  • Produced by KYN Yapım, Kafkas brings together a proven creative team.
  • Screenwriter Mehmet Ercan Erdem, known for his strong narrative structures and complex characters, has crafted a story that delves into identity, honor, and the modern struggle between tradition and progress.
  • Director Mustafa Şevki Doğan, one of Turkey’s most respected filmmakers, adds a cinematic touch that promises to elevate Kafkas beyond the usual TV drama format.

This collaboration is expected to deliver a high-quality production with visually stunning cinematography and emotionally charged storytelling — a hallmark of modern Turkish television that has gained global popularity through streaming platforms.

The Story of “Kafkas”: Loyalty, Struggle, and Power

In Kafkas, Oktay Kaynarca portrays a resilient, land-rooted businessman — a man deeply connected to his homeland and values. His character embodies the essence of strength, leadership, and unwavering determination in the face of corruption and conflict.

The title Kafkas (meaning “Caucasus”) hints at themes of origin, identity, and resilience — suggesting a story tied to cultural roots, community, and a man’s battle to protect what he holds dear.

While details about the plot remain under wraps, industry insiders suggest that the series will feature intense emotional drama, political undertones, and family conflicts — all hallmarks of the Turkish storytelling tradition that appeals to audiences worldwide.

Filming Outside Istanbul: A Strategic Creative Choice

Unlike many Turkish series filmed in Istanbul, Kafkas will be shot entirely outside the city.
This decision highlights the producers’ intent to capture the authentic beauty of Turkey’s lesser-known regions — possibly in the Black Sea or Anatolian territories — providing the series with a unique visual identity.

The rural and natural settings are expected to reflect the earthy, passionate tone of the narrative, grounding Kafkas in the real textures of Turkish life.

Oktay Kaynarca’s Dual Momentum: “Kafkas” and “Başkan”

In addition to Kafkas, Kaynarca recently completed filming “Başkan” (The Mayor) for Gain, a digital streaming platform rapidly growing in Turkey’s entertainment landscape.

In Başkan, he portrays Aziz Saygın, a mayor placed under house arrest, navigating political intrigue and moral dilemmas. The role marks a stark contrast to Kafkas, showcasing the actor’s extraordinary range — from a man confined by power to one who wields it.

The series is highly anticipated, with many fans eager to see when Başkan will premiere on Gain’s digital platform.

ATV’s Winning Streak Continues

Kafkas will air on ATV, one of Turkey’s top-rated television networks and home to many acclaimed series.
ATV’s recent lineup has been focused on expanding its international distribution network, with its dramas reaching over 60 countries.

By partnering again with Kaynarca, ATV reinforces its commitment to delivering content that appeals both to domestic audiences and the global diaspora of Turkish drama fans.

Industry Buzz and Audience Expectations

According to early reports from Turkish entertainment outlets, the first table reads and production meetings are already underway.
Kaynarca is reportedly in final discussions with ATV executives before the project officially begins filming in December 2025, with a projected release in early 2026.

Fans are eager to see Kaynarca in another commanding role after his departure from Ben Bu Cihana Sığmazam, a series that enjoyed strong ratings and a passionate fan base.

The Broader Impact of Turkish TV on Global Audiences

The rise of Turkish series on global streaming platforms has reshaped the international entertainment market.
According to Variety and Forbes, Turkish dramas are now the second most exported TV content worldwide, after American series.

Shows like Kafkas represent not only entertainment but also cultural diplomacy, introducing international audiences to Turkish landscapes, language, and values.

This makes Kafkas not just another TV series, but part of a growing cultural movement that positions Turkey as a global storytelling powerhouse.

Quick summary of the article:

Oktay Kaynarca (famous Turkish actor & host of “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?” in Turkey) is preparing a new TV series titled “Kafkas.”

  • Produced by KYN Yapım
  • Written by Mehmet Ercan Erdem
  • Directed by Mustafa Şevki Doğan
  • Filming will take place outside Istanbul
  • Kaynarca plays a patriotic, strong-willed businessman named Kafkas.
  • Shooting begins in December, aiming to air in early 2026 on ATV.
  • Separately, Kaynarca also stars in “Başkan” (The Mayor) for Gain, where he plays Aziz Saygın, a mayor under house arrest.
